Monday 16th July 2007
TESCO RECEIVES AGREEMENT FROM NETWORK RAIL FOR NEW TUNNEL DESIGN AT GERRARDS CROSS
Tesco announced today that Network Rail has agreed in principle to a new conceptual design for the rail tunnel in Gerrards Cross on which the new Tesco supermarket will be built.
Known as ‘Form A Approval in Principle’, this is the first in a series of approvals that will be required from Network Rail as work progresses. The design of the revised tunnel structure has been produced by a new team that was appointed by Tesco last year to oversee the development. The team is led by international engineering and construction group Costain and design consultants Scott Wilson.
Tesco spokesperson Michael Kissman commented: “We are pleased that Network Rail has agreed in principle to the new design concept developed by our team. This is a significant step in the rigorous approvals process. During the next few months we will be working closely with Network Rail to agree the detailed design of the tunnel. Network Rail will also maintain a presence on site when the development is underway.”
Substantially more robust than other solutions which have been reviewed, the revised structure design is based on a reinforced concrete arch constructed over the top of the existing pre-cast units. The new arch will take the main structural load but the original segmental arches will remain in place.
